If you are asking if all Model 14-1s were made as SAO, the answer is no. Without some form of legitimate provenance, as far as I know, there is no way to know how it left the factory.
I have a 14-1, and when I purchased it, it was a double action revolver, just as I supposed it would be. I lettered it and found that it was ordered and shipped as a SAO variation. At some point, the SA hammer was replaced with a DA hammer. But without that letter, I would never have known the difference.
Early on, S&W sold SA hammer/trigger sets in a blister pack that anyone could purchase and swap out the DA parts. Again, without that provenance (proof), I know of no way to tell whether a Model 14 left the factory in SA or DA configuration.
